OpenAI has announced an expansion of its Trusted Access for Cyber (TAC) program, aimed at enhancing cybersecurity defenses by providing thousands of verified defenders with access to advanced AI tools tailored for defensive purposes. The latest iteration, GPT-5.4-Cyber, is specifically designed for cybersecurity applications, offering capabilities such as binary reverse engineering to analyze software for vulnerabilities without requiring source code access. This model comes as a response to the need for robust defenses against increasingly sophisticated cyber threats, acknowledging that both defenders and attackers are leveraging advanced AI technologies. The significance of this initiative lies in its objective to democratize access to powerful AI tools while establishing strict safeguards to prevent misuse. OpenAI's approach is grounded in three principles: providing inclusive access to legitimate users, iterative improvements based on real-world deployment, and fostering community resilience through support and open-source contributions. By fine-tuning its models and granting broader access to cybersecurity professionals, OpenAI aims to not only accelerate defenders' capabilities but also maintain heightened security amidst the evolving landscape of cyber threats. This progressive strategy includes ongoing monitoring and validation of users to ensure responsible deployment of AI technology in critical cybersecurity workflows.
